Budget-friendly Travel

London is very well connected by the Tube (the Underground). Visitors can select a multiple day pass which costs less than having to purchase daily tickets. Supplement this with walking around the city, using buses and taking trams and you can use that extra money to explore some more. Travel by train from London to Scotland and enjoy the lush countryside without creating a dent in your wallet.

Where to Stay

When in London, source out backpacker-style Bed and Breakfasts that offer good deals to shoestring budget travelers. There are several fine hotels and guest houses all across the United Kingdom. You can easily find cheap but comfortable accommodation.

Budget Airlines

There are many budget airlines that operate regular flights to and from any place in the United Kingdom. Virgin Atlantic and Ryanair are good options. You can call airline offices to check for special rates and even book online. If you are traveling from France or another European country, you can choose the Eurostar, the ferry across the English Channel, or even drive to the United Kingdom, crossing the water by ferry.
